Washington DC LLC Formation has fewer formalities than a corporation, in some cases. One of the statutes for corporations is, by law, the corporate shareholders have to meet at least annually and meeting minutes need to be documented. The Washington DC Limited Liability Company operating agreement can provide a provision for annual meetings of the owners, or lack thereof. Washington DC LLC is not required, by law, to hold meetings of the interest holders, however it is a good practice in order to maintain the protection provided against liability as required by officers and directors. Washington DC llc formation creates a separate legal entity that shields the owners of the business from liability, debt and contractual obligations, the business is viewed as a separate "person" that is responsible for the Washington DC LLC liabilities. In order to maximize the protection the company can provide, it must be operated correctly. Examples of these formalities include filings to maintain standing with the Washington DC State Office, as well as operational formalities, such as not commingling personal and company funds and documenting business decisions made by the officers in annual meeting minutes of the shareholders. Washington DC Limited Liability Company is a strong alternative to an unincorporated business or a corporation. There are many ways to take advantage of the limited liability of a Washington DC LLC and Washington DC llc formation adds a layer of protection for the business owners. The company is a separate legal entity and is responsible for its debts; therefore a creditor cannot seize the business owners’ assets for company debts. This is not the case if the owners of the company personally sign for debts or sign guarantees personally.
